The prongs have always been removable. They always gave us two sets, long and short prongs.
Rule 20...." Transmitters for electronic training collars must be left in vehicle........"
Prongs or no prongs, you carry that Alpha on your belt , you are scratched and possibly barred.
UKC doesn't change rules. The breed associations do that and they only do it every 3 years.
How do you get around all that? You don't.
